Right now teams are built like an afterthought. They don't have access to projects, status pages, backups, etc.
Because of that we're using a single user to be able to do all that and this is a security issue.
Creating a multi tennant organisation that actually owns the accounts and has a central configuration and permissions would actually solve a lot of the issues we're currently having.
It would also make more sense to structure ploi like this (as a lot of other services do).
It would also open up charging a fee per user ... in addition to features.
This would also allow implementing features like SSO/SAML to ploi to streamline user management from a central identity service. When having more than 4-6 users it's really hard to keep track who's doing what.
